What deposit methods does Joka Casino offer?
Joka Casino provides a variety of deposit options. Players can typically use credit cards, e-wallets, and cryptocurrencies. Here’s a breakdown:
- Credit/Debit Cards: Visa, Mastercard
- E-wallets: Skrill, Neteller, ecoPayz
- Cryptocurrencies: Bitcoin, Ethereum
Deposits are usually instant, allowing you to start playing immediately. The minimum deposit amount is generally set at $10 NZD, making it accessible for most players.
Are there any fees for deposits?
Most deposit methods at Joka Casino are free of charge, which is a positive aspect for players looking to maximise their funds. However, always check your payment provider’s policies, as they might impose fees. For example, credit card companies may have their own charges that you need to be aware of.
What withdrawal options are available?
Withdrawing your winnings can be a different story. Joka Casino offers several methods, including:
- Bank Transfers: Typically the slowest option, taking up to 5 business days.
- E-wallets: Faster, often completed within 24 hours.
- Cryptocurrencies: Usually processed within a few hours.
Withdrawal requests are subject to processing times, which can take anywhere from 23 to 47 hours depending on the method chosen.
What are the withdrawal limits?
The minimum withdrawal amount at Joka Casino is around $20 NZD. It’s also important to note that some withdrawal methods may have different limits, so always review the terms before proceeding. For example, e-wallets might allow quicker and higher withdrawal limits compared to bank transfers.
Are there any wagering requirements on bonuses?
Yes, Joka Casino imposes wagering requirements on bonuses. The standard requirement is around 37x your bonus amount. This means if you receive a bonus of $100 NZD, you’ll need to wager $3,700 NZD before you can withdraw any winnings associated with that bonus. Keep this in mind when claiming offers, as they can affect your overall gaming experience.
How safe are my payment details?
Joka Casino employs standard security measures, including SSL encryption, to protect your financial information. However, since it operates offshore, it lacks a New Zealand licence. This means that while your data is likely secure, you should always exercise caution when sharing sensitive information with online casinos. Consider using e-wallets or cryptocurrencies for added security.
What should I know about currency options?
Joka Casino primarily operates in NZD, which is convenient for Kiwi players. However, if you opt for cryptocurrencies, the exchange rates can fluctuate, potentially affecting the amount you receive upon withdrawal. Always check the current rates if you’re using this method.
Can I use the same method for deposits and withdrawals?
Yes, Joka Casino generally allows you to use the same method for both deposits and withdrawals. This is convenient and ensures a smoother transaction experience. However, be aware that some methods may have restrictions or additional verification steps for withdrawals.
